The Advantages of Sliding Aluminium Doors
Moving aluminum doors feature a huge selection of benefits that add to their increasing appeal. Here's an in-depth breakdown:
Advantage
Description
Durability
Aluminum is extremely resistant to rust, corrosion, and weather condition elements, making it ideal for outdoor use.
Low Maintenance
Unlike wood, aluminum does not require regular repainting or sealing, which saves money and time.
Energy Efficiency
Modern sliding aluminum doors are typically geared up with double or triple glazing, enhancing insulation and decreasing energy costs.
Visual Appeal
With their smooth, modern look, these doors can enhance the visual appeal of any space.
Space-Saving Design
Moving doors do not require additional area for swinging open, making them perfect for little areas.
Adjustable Options
Aluminum doors can be tailored in regards to size, surface, and color, permitting a tailored interior design.
Design Options
When it pertains to develop, moving aluminum doors offer a remarkable series of alternatives. Here are some popular styles:
Bi-Fold Doors: These doors consist of several panels that fold back versus each other, providing a large opening that links indoor and outdoor areas.
Pocket Doors: Sliding pocket doors vanish into the wall when opened, creating a seamless transition between rooms without sacrificing area.
Multi-Slide Doors: These systems include multiple moving panels that stack on one side or split in the middle, maximizing the opening.
Custom-made Colors and Finishes: Aluminum doors can be powder-coated in numerous colors to match any style plan, offering options like matte, gloss, or textured finishes.

Upkeep Tips
While moving aluminum doors are fairly low-maintenance, proper care can improve their lifespan. Here are some p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Use a soft cloth and mild detergent to clean up the frames and glass. Avoid abrasive cleaners that can scratch the surface.
Lubricate Tracks: Periodically apply lube to the door tracks to guarantee smooth operation and prevent the accumulation of dirt and debris.
Weatherstripping Check: Inspect the seals and weatherstripping for wear and tears to keep energy efficiency and prevent drafts.
Glass Care: For glass panels, utilize a glass cleaner to keep the view clear and intense.
Frame Inspection: Regularly look for any damages or scratches on the frame and repair them without delay to avoid rust.
Setup Considerations
The installation of sliding aluminum doors is a specific task that needs correct preparation and execution. Here are some vital factors to remember:
- Professional Installation: Hiring an expert makes sure that the doors are fitted correctly for ideal performance and energy efficiency.
- Structural Support: Ensure that the opening where the door will be set up has the correct structural support to bear the weight of the door.
- Accessibility: Consider the needs of all potential users; make sure that door handles are at a comfortable height and the track is available for everyone, consisting of those with mobility obstacles.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are sliding aluminum doors energy-efficient?
Yes, lots of moving aluminum doors are designed with energy performance in mind. Features like double or triple-glazed glass can significantly decrease heat transfer, thus reducing energy costs.
2. How much do moving aluminum doors cost?
The cost differs extensively based upon size, style, and modification. Usually, homeowners can expect to pay between 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 per door, consisting of installation.
3. Can sliding aluminum doors be utilized in cold climates?
Definitely! Top quality sliding aluminum doors are well-insulated and can carry out effectively even in cold climates, especially when outfitted with thermal breaks.
4. What colors can I select from?
Aluminum doors can be powder-coated in essentially any color, permitting house owners to choose finishes that finest match their current decoration.
5. The length of time do moving aluminum doors last?
With proper upkeep, moving aluminum doors can last for years. The durability of aluminum makes it a long-lasting option for homeowners.
